What Defines Excellent Customer Service in the Airline Industry?

Before we explore the top airlines, it’s important to understand the key elements that define outstanding customer service in aviation. While safety remains the top priority, modern travelers expect more than just a safe flight—they seek comfort, efficiency, responsiveness, and personalization throughout their journey. The following factors play a crucial role in shaping a positive customer experience:

  • Prompt and courteous communication : Whether through phone support, live chat, or social media, airlines that respond quickly and politely to inquiries gain trust.
  • Seamless booking and check-in processes : User-friendly websites, mobile apps, and streamlined check-in options enhance convenience.
  • Baggage handling and tracking : Transparent policies and real-time baggage updates reduce stress and confusion.
  • Onboard hospitality : Attentive cabin crew, high-quality meals, and personalized services elevate the flying experience.
  • Handling delays and cancellations : Proactive communication, rebooking assistance, and compensation policies significantly impact customer satisfaction.
  • Loyalty programs and frequent flyer benefits : Rewarding loyal customers with perks fosters long-term relationships.
  • Accessibility and inclusivity : Ensuring that all passengers, including those with disabilities, receive appropriate care and accommodations.

1. Qatar Airways – Consistently Ranked Among the World’s Best

Qatar Airways has repeatedly been recognized as one of the world’s leading airlines, not only for its luxurious amenities but also for its exemplary customer service. Based in Doha, the national carrier of Qatar has built a reputation for excellence through meticulous attention to detail and a commitment to passenger comfort.

Why Qatar Airways Stands Out in Customer Service

One of the standout features of Qatar Airways is its award-winning cabin crew, known for their professionalism, multilingual capabilities, and warm demeanor. Passengers frequently praise the attentive service onboard, noting that staff go above and beyond to ensure a pleasant journey. Additionally, the airline’s digital platforms offer seamless booking experiences, real-time flight updates, and responsive customer support via multiple channels.

2. Singapore Airlines – Setting the Benchmark for Premium Travel

Singapore Airlines (SIA) is synonymous with luxury and sophistication. As the flag carrier of Singapore, it has maintained its position as a global leader in aviation by consistently delivering world-class service across all classes of travel.

Exceptional Service from Booking to Arrival

From the outset, Singapore Airlines ensures a smooth and hassle-free booking process. Its website and mobile app are intuitive, allowing passengers to customize their itineraries, select preferred seats, and manage bookings with ease. The airline also offers 24/7 customer support via phone, email, and social media, ensuring that travelers receive prompt assistance whenever needed.

Onboard, Singapore Airlines elevates the flying experience with its renowned SilverKris Lounge, which serves premium passengers with gourmet dining, spa-like amenities, and quiet relaxation zones. The airline’s First Class cabins are particularly noteworthy, featuring fully enclosed suites with lie-flat beds, designer bedding, and Michelin-starred cuisine prepared by expert chefs.

Customer service extends beyond the skies. At Changi Airport, Singapore Airlines operates one of the most sophisticated transit hubs, offering seamless connections and a wide range of retail and dining options. Passengers transiting through Singapore benefit from efficient immigration clearance, making layovers convenient and stress-free.

In the event of flight disruptions, Singapore Airlines maintains clear communication protocols and ensures that affected passengers are promptly informed and accommodated. The KrisFlyer loyalty program further enhances the travel experience by offering tier-based benefits, including lounge access, extra baggage allowance, and exclusive promotions.

4. ANA All Nippon Airways – Japan’s Premier Carrier for Polished Service

ANA All Nippon Airways, Japan’s largest airline, is celebrated for its refined approach to customer service. Rooted in Japanese hospitality (omotenashi), ANA delivers a level of courtesy and attentiveness that resonates deeply with international travelers.

Cultural Excellence Meets Modern Aviation Standards

ANA’s commitment to excellence begins with its rigorous training programs for cabin crew. Flight attendants undergo extensive instruction in etiquette, language proficiency, and emergency response, ensuring that they provide service that is both professional and personable. Passengers often highlight the warmth and respect shown by ANA staff, particularly during long-haul flights.

Technologically, ANA has embraced innovation to enhance the travel experience. The airline’s mobile app allows users to check in, track flights, and access real-time updates seamlessly. Additionally, ANA’s partnership with United Airlines and Star Alliance provides passengers with expanded route options and seamless connectivity.

Inflight, ANA offers a diverse selection of Japanese and international cuisine, carefully curated to reflect regional flavors while maintaining high nutritional standards. The airline’s premium cabins, especially its Boeing 787-based First Class suites, are designed for ultimate privacy and comfort, featuring full-length flat beds, premium linens, and high-end toiletries from Shiseido.

Ground services at Tokyo Narita and Haneda airports are equally impressive, with dedicated lounges, expedited security lanes, and multilingual assistance available to international guests. ANA Mileage Club members enjoy tier-based privileges, including lounge access, bonus miles, and flexible redemption options.

During operational challenges, ANA demonstrates resilience by proactively communicating with passengers and minimizing inconvenience through swift rebooking and compensation measures.


5. Cathay Pacific – Elevating Travel Across Asia and Beyond

Cathay Pacific, headquartered in Hong Kong, is widely regarded as one of Asia’s premier airlines. With a focus on connecting East and West, Cathay Pacific has built a reputation for superior service, cultural sensitivity, and operational efficiency.

A Harmonious Blend of Tradition and Innovation

Cathay Pacific’s dedication to customer service is evident in every aspect of the travel experience. From the moment passengers book their flights, they encounter a user-friendly interface that supports multiple languages and currencies. The airline’s customer service team is known for its bilingual capabilities, ensuring that travelers from diverse backgrounds receive accurate and helpful guidance.

Inflight, Cathay Pacific offers a refined culinary experience, with menus crafted by celebrity chefs and tailored to different routes. The airline’s signature dishes, such as dim sum and Cantonese-style roasted meats, reflect its deep-rooted connection to Chinese cuisine while catering to global tastes.

Premium travelers benefit from the Marco Polo Club, which grants access to exclusive lounges, priority check-in, and enhanced baggage allowances. Cathay Pacific’s Business Class and First Class cabins are designed for maximum comfort, featuring lie-flat seats, premium bedding, and personalized service from attentive cabin crews.

At Hong Kong International Airport (HKIA), Cathay Pacific operates one of the most comprehensive hub networks, offering seamless connections to destinations across Asia, Europe, North America, and Oceania. The airline’s ground staff is trained to assist passengers with special requirements, ensuring that individuals with mobility challenges or medical needs receive appropriate care.

In times of disruption, Cathay Pacific maintains a proactive approach, keeping passengers informed through multiple channels and offering rebooking options without unnecessary delays. The airline’s commitment to sustainability and responsible travel further enhances its appeal to conscientious travelers.


6. Lufthansa – Germany’s Flag Carrier with a Focus on Precision and Efficiency

Lufthansa, the national airline of Germany, is renowned for its punctuality, engineering excellence, and structured approach to customer service. As a founding member of the Star Alliance, Lufthansa plays a pivotal role in connecting Europe with global destinations.

Precision Engineering Meets Personalized Hospitality

Lufthansa’s strength lies in its ability to combine German efficiency with traditional hospitality. The airline’s booking and check-in systems are highly organized, allowing passengers to manage their itineraries with minimal effort. Online tools such as Lufthansa’s mobile app and web portal enable real-time flight tracking, seat selection, and document verification.

Onboard, Lufthansa emphasizes consistency in service delivery. Economy class passengers enjoy ergonomic seating, complimentary meals, and a robust entertainment system. Business and First Class travelers are treated to private suites, fine dining, and exclusive lounges at Frankfurt and Munich airports.

The Miles & More loyalty program is one of the most flexible frequent flyer schemes in Europe, offering members the ability to earn and redeem points across multiple partner airlines and non-airline partners. Tiered membership benefits include lounge access, priority boarding, and bonus miles, enhancing the value proposition for regular travelers.

Ground operations at Frankfurt Airport (FRA) and Munich Airport (MUC) are optimized for efficiency, with streamlined transfer procedures and multilingual customer support. Lufthansa’s crisis management protocols ensure that passengers receive timely assistance in case of flight disruptions, including hotel accommodations and alternative routing.

By integrating technology with human-centered service principles, Lufthansa continues to uphold its status as a leader in European aviation.
